Powerful NVIDIA Smartphone Chips Launching Soon - Qualcomm Has Competition
NVIDIA Tegra 2

NVIDIA, the computer graphics chip maker, had also started making smartphone chips sometime back.


Though the start was a little rough (remember the scrapped Microsoft Kin smartphones which featured the NVIDIA Tegra chips?), the company seems all geared up now, to move ahead with vigor. Earlier this year, they announced the much powerful Tegra 2 chips for smartphones. These new processors are supposed to be four times more faster than the initial Tegra chips. Not just that, they can also play 1080p videos, in contrast to the first Tegras, which could play only 720p content. Power-efficiency-wise too, the NVIDIA Tegra 2 is said to have beat the predecessor.


LG Optimus Smartphone

LG, the Korean mobile phone maker, might be the first to release smartphones sporting the Tegra 2 processors. A report from Wall Street Journal indicates that the LG Optimus smartphones line will be featuring dual core NVIDIA processors. The best mobile phones are going to be based on Google's Android platform. They are expected to be available in the market later on this year.


Qualcomm, which had almost monopolised the processor market for high-end smartphones, now has some competition to look forward to. However, they seem quite determined to hold their ground. New powerful Snapdragon dual-core processors from Qualcomm are on the cards as well. These 1.5GHz processors will also support 1080p videos. Top-notch smartphones and tablets, featuring these processors are to set foot into the markets very soon.
